Transaction 6b66069af16d25d0f07b853abb048d358a8bd6028c4b86f93a1fd3a569f8c8a8
1 Input
1 Output
-
6b66069af16d25d0f07b853abb048d358a8bd6028c4b86f93a1fd3a569f8c8a8:0
- value
- 828562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a790b26404543adba913ccbc275fb8978487aa5 OP_EQUAL
- address
- 35ZbJrVRpBs2fJX85966DAkGRT3qZSVjW4